The crane-supporting steel structures design guide 4th edition 2021 pdf is an essential resource for structural engineers and industrial facility designers. This comprehensive document, published by the Canadian Institute of Steel Construction (CISC), provides standardized procedures for designing crane runways and supporting structures.
